James Corbett

2014 - PerkinElmer

In 2014, James Corbett earned a total compensation of $1.4M as Executive Vice President and President, Discovery and Analytical Solutions at PerkinElmer, a 35% increase compared to previous year.

Corbett received $443.9K in non-equity incentive plan, accounting for 32% of the total pay in 2014.

Corbett also received $266.6K in option awards, $383.1K in salary, $266.7K in stock awards and $17K in other compensation.

Rankings

In 2014, James Corbett's compensation ranked 6,164th out of 13,032 executives tracked by ExecPay. In other words, Corbett earned more than 52.7% of executives.
